+ async fn load_rust_language(
+ workspace: WeakEntity<Workspace>,
+ cx: &mut AsyncApp,
+ ) -> Arc<Language> {
+ let rust_language_task = workspace
+ .read_with(cx, |workspace, cx| {
+ workspace
+ .project()
+ .read(cx)
+ .languages()
+ .language_for_name("Rust")
+ })
+ .context("Failed to load Rust language")
+ .log_err();
+ let rust_language = match rust_language_task {
+ Some(task) => task.await.context("Failed to load Rust language").log_err(),
+ None => None,
+ };
+ return rust_language.unwrap_or_else(|| {
+ Arc::new(Language::new(
+ LanguageConfig {
+ name: "Rust".into(),
+ ..Default::default()
+ },
+ Some(tree_sitter_rust::LANGUAGE.into()),
+ ))
+ });
+ }
